I invite guests to share personal stories about acts of leadership that help shape their lives. In Episode 99, Mark McNally talks about a friend’s observation that raises Mark’s awareness about his work balance. He then shares a story about a company he took public, which transitioned to a discussion about transparency, vulnerability, trust, and loyalty. Mark also advises us to challenge our assumptions.


Prologue


Of all the officers of companies who I’ve met, Mark is the first one with the title Chief Nobody (Co-founder and Chief Nobody of Nobody Studios). He is an accomplished product and marketing executive who has successfully scaled organizations from startup to multinational establishments. He has traveled to more than forty countries and almost all the U.S. states to collaborate with customers and investors.


01:25 Part 1: Shifting Gears to Maintain Balance


After five days of being on a stage talking to customers and investors, a friend explains an observation that raises Mark’s awareness of balancing what he does.


06:42 Part 2: Trust Is More Powerful than Spinning a Narrative


Mark starts with a story about the pressures of a company that goes public. The story transitions to a discussion about the value of trust, loyalty, vulnerability, and transparency.


16:02 Part 3: Red Teaming


Do we justify our conclusions about our career choices? Mark advises us to challenge or have someone else challenge our assumptions.
